OVERRIDE ENTRIES

Programmed limit for functions (such as for maximum amounts) can be overridden by making an entry in the MGR mode.

1.

2.

Turn the mode switch to the MGR position. Make an override entry.

On this example, the register has been programmed not to allow deduction entries over 1.00.

CORRECTION AFTER FINALIZING A

TRANSACTION (AFTER GENERATING A RECEIPT)

When you need to void incorrect entries that cashiers cannot correct (incorrect entries that are found after finalizing a transaction or cannot be corrected by direct or indirect void), follow this procedure.

1.Turn the mode switch to the position using the manager key (MA).

2.Repeat the entries that are recorded on an incorrect receipt. (All data for the incorrect receipt are removed from register memory; the voided amounts are added to the void-mode transaction totalizer.)
